Pythonでリスト(配列)の中身を検索するには、様々な方法があります。以下に、いくつかの方法を紹介します。
in 演算子を使う方法
my_list = [1, 2, 3, 4, 5] if 3 in my_list: print("3 is in the list")
list.index() メソッドを使う方法
my_list = [1, 2, 3, 4, 5] try: index = my_list.index(3) print(f"3 is at index {index}") except ValueError: print("3 is not in the list")
リスト内包表記を使う方法
my_list = [1, 2, 3, 4, 5] result = [x for x in my_list if x == 3] if result: print("3 is in the list") else: print("3 is not in the list")
上記のように、複数の方法がありますので、どの方法を使用するかは、プログラムの要件や好みに応じて選択することができます。
コメント